1. Book Early to Lock in Better Prices
Rental rates often increase as the date of travel approaches. Booking a car in advance can help lock in lower rates. Airlines and rental agencies adjust pricing based on demand, so early planning often translates to savings. Even a few weeks’ notice can make a significant difference.
Additionally, booking early allows you to choose from a wider selection of vehicles. From economy cars to SUVs, early reservations give the chance to pick the model that suits your travel needs best.
2. Compare Multiple Rental Companies
Prices vary across rental companies, even at the same airport. Taking time to check multiple providers online can reveal hidden savings. Websites and apps often display daily rates, insurance costs, and extra fees.
Using comparison tools lets you quickly identify deals that match your budget. Reading reviews also helps understand which companies provide smooth pickup and drop-off experiences. Simple research can prevent surprises later.
3. Consider Pickup and Drop-Off Timing
Rental car prices often fluctuate depending on the day and time. Weekends or peak tourist seasons may cost more than weekdays. If your schedule allows, adjusting pickup and drop-off times can reduce charges.
Late-night or early-morning rentals sometimes include extra fees. Planning around standard business hours often ensures smoother service without additional costs. Simple timing adjustments can save you money and stress.
4. Evaluate Insurance Options Carefully
Many travelers automatically select the insurance offered by rental companies. But this can increase costs significantly. Check whether your personal car insurance or credit card covers rental vehicles.
If coverage exists, you may decline extra insurance at the counter. This step alone can cut rental expenses by 20–30%. Understanding insurance requirements in advance ensures you avoid paying for unnecessary add-ons.
5. Look for Discounts and Coupons
Coupons, loyalty programs, and credit card promotions can lower rental prices. Some companies offer discounts for online reservations or prepaid rentals. Memberships with organizations like AAA or AARP can also provide savings.
Even small discounts add up, especially for longer trips. A quick search for promotional codes before booking can result in significant cost reductions without any extra effort.
6. Choose the Right Vehicle for Your Needs
Selecting the proper vehicle is key to avoiding hidden charges. Large SUVs and luxury cars cost more in rental fees and fuel. If you plan to stay in the city or explore nearby areas, economy or compact cars may be ideal.
Fuel efficiency is another factor. Cars that consume less fuel help save on trips to Anchorage’s scenic spots. Picking a vehicle that balances comfort, price, and fuel economy makes the experience both enjoyable and budget-friendly.
7. Review Fuel Policies Carefully
Rental companies offer different fuel options. Full-to-full is usually the most economical choice. This means you pick up the car with a full tank and return it full. Prepaid fuel can be convenient but may cost more.
Understanding the fuel policy prevents extra charges on return. Small details like this often impact the final cost more than expected. Clear knowledge of fuel rules ensures a smooth rental experience.
8. Inspect the Car Thoroughly Before Driving
Inspecting the vehicle before leaving the lot is essential. Check for scratches, dents, or mechanical issues and document them with photos. This protects you from being charged for damages you didn’t cause.
A careful inspection may seem simple, but it saves headaches later. Rental companies appreciate responsible clients, and clear documentation ensures transparency.
9. Flexibility Can Save Money
Being flexible with car size, pickup locations, or rental dates often results in lower prices. If airport rentals are expensive, checking off-site locations nearby may help. Short adjustments in travel plans can lead to significant savings.
Flexibility also allows travelers to take advantage of last-minute promotions or discounts. Even small changes can reduce overall rental expenses substantially.
10. Keep an Eye on Extra Fees
Additional charges can increase the total rental cost. Extras like GPS, child seats, or additional drivers often come at a premium. Decide in advance which add-ons are necessary.
Sometimes, apps on your phone can replace GPS. Friends or family may not require an additional driver fee. Being aware of potential extras ensures you only pay for what’s needed.

FAQs
1. Is it cheaper to book a rental car online or at the airport?
Booking online in advance usually offers lower rates and a wider selection compared to last-minute airport rentals.
2. Can my personal car insurance cover airport rentals?
Many personal policies cover rental cars. Check your insurance provider to avoid paying for extra coverage unnecessarily.
3. Are off-airport rental locations better for deals?
Sometimes, yes. Off-airport locations may have lower rates and fewer fees, though airport pickups are more convenient.
4. How can I avoid hidden fees with rental cars?
Read rental agreements carefully, inspect the car, understand fuel policies, and consider which add-ons are truly necessary.
5. What’s the best way to save money on long-term rentals?
Book early, use promotional codes, select fuel-efficient cars, and avoid unnecessary insurance or extras to reduce long-term rental costs.
